Describe your college experience

My transition into college was super exciting but also confusing at the same time. As a first generation student, much of the information and opportunities I found were all dependent on my own efforts in networking and doing my research. But once I got past these initial struggles, I genuinely started identifying this campus as my second home. However, I can't say that my experience the next few years has been without struggle, because there were so many personal growth and academic challenges that I had to tackle along the way. But every single moment has contributed wonderfully into finding my place here, and it's made my college experience so incredibly rich and fulfilling. I feel incredibly lucky to call UCSD my second home and to have it play such an important chapter in my life.

Favorite class

BILD 1,2 were very interesting basic biology classes that gave me a better idea about how human bodies work. CHEM 108 was a great experience in getting biochemistry lab experience. MGT 103 was so informative and relevant to today's world, and learning about marketing techniques and building a project at the end of the class was really interesting.
